Home
last modified time | relevance | path

Searched refs:pool_link (Results 1 – 13 of 13) sorted by relevance

/third_party/mesa3d/src/gallium/frontends/lavapipe/
Dlvp_cmd_buffer.c55 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in lvp_create_cmd_buffer()
60 list_inithead(&cmd_buffer->pool_link); in lvp_create_cmd_buffer()
91 …d_buffer *cmd_buffer = list_first_entry(&pool->free_cmd_buffers, struct lvp_cmd_buffer, pool_link); in lvp_AllocateCommandBuffers()
93 list_del(&cmd_buffer->pool_link); in lvp_AllocateCommandBuffers()
94 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in lvp_AllocateCommandBuffers()
127 list_del(&cmd_buffer->pool_link); in lvp_cmd_buffer_destroy()
143 list_del(&cmd_buffer->pool_link); in lvp_FreeCommandBuffers()
144 list_addtail(&cmd_buffer->pool_link, &cmd_buffer->pool->free_cmd_buffers); in lvp_FreeCommandBuffers()
224 &pool->cmd_buffers, pool_link) { in lvp_DestroyCommandPool()
229 &pool->free_cmd_buffers, pool_link) { in lvp_DestroyCommandPool()
[all …]
Dlvp_private.h584 struct list_head pool_link; member
/third_party/mesa3d/src/panfrost/vulkan/
Dpanvk_vX_cmd_buffer.c981 list_del(&cmdbuf->pool_link); in panvk_destroy_cmdbuf()
1026 list_addtail(&cmdbuf->pool_link, &pool->active_cmd_buffers); in panvk_create_cmdbuf()
1032 list_inithead(&cmdbuf->pool_link); in panvk_create_cmdbuf()
1067 &pool->free_cmd_buffers, struct panvk_cmd_buffer, pool_link); in panvk_per_arch()
1069 list_del(&cmdbuf->pool_link); in panvk_per_arch()
1070 list_addtail(&cmdbuf->pool_link, &pool->active_cmd_buffers); in panvk_per_arch()
1107 list_del(&cmdbuf->pool_link); in panvk_per_arch()
1109 list_addtail(&cmdbuf->pool_link, in panvk_per_arch()
1158 &pool->active_cmd_buffers, pool_link) in panvk_per_arch()
1162 &pool->free_cmd_buffers, pool_link) in panvk_per_arch()
[all …]
Dpanvk_private.h650 struct list_head pool_link; member
/third_party/mesa3d/src/intel/vulkan/
Danv_cmd_buffer.c301 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in anv_create_cmd_buffer()
348 list_del(&cmd_buffer->pool_link); in anv_cmd_buffer_destroy()
1303 &pool->cmd_buffers, pool_link) { in anv_DestroyCommandPool()
1318 &pool->cmd_buffers, pool_link) { in anv_ResetCommandPool()
Danv_descriptor_set.c910 &pool->desc_sets, pool_link) { in anv_DestroyDescriptorPool()
932 &pool->desc_sets, pool_link) { in anv_ResetDescriptorPool()
1151 list_addtail(&set->pool_link, &pool->desc_sets); in anv_descriptor_set_create()
1175 list_del(&set->pool_link); in anv_descriptor_set_destroy()
Danv_private.h2013 struct list_head pool_link; member
3088 struct list_head pool_link; member
/third_party/mesa3d/src/freedreno/vulkan/
Dtu_cmd_buffer.c1411 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in tu_create_cmd_buffer()
1418 list_inithead(&cmd_buffer->pool_link); in tu_create_cmd_buffer()
1438 list_del(&cmd_buffer->pool_link); in tu_cmd_buffer_destroy()
1495 &pool->free_cmd_buffers, struct tu_cmd_buffer, pool_link); in tu_AllocateCommandBuffers()
1497 list_del(&cmd_buffer->pool_link); in tu_AllocateCommandBuffers()
1498 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in tu_AllocateCommandBuffers()
1548 list_del(&cmd_buffer->pool_link); in tu_FreeCommandBuffers()
1549 list_addtail(&cmd_buffer->pool_link, in tu_FreeCommandBuffers()
3056 &pool->cmd_buffers, pool_link) in tu_DestroyCommandPool()
3062 &pool->free_cmd_buffers, pool_link) in tu_DestroyCommandPool()
[all …]
Dtu_private.h1060 struct list_head pool_link; member
/third_party/mesa3d/src/broadcom/vulkan/
Dv3dv_cmd_buffer.c138 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in cmd_buffer_init()
349 list_del(&cmd_buffer->pool_link); in cmd_buffer_destroy()
886 list_del(&cmd_buffer->pool_link); in cmd_buffer_reset()
957 &pool->cmd_buffers, pool_link) { in v3dv_DestroyCommandPool()
1170 &pool->cmd_buffers, pool_link) { in v3dv_ResetCommandPool()
Dv3dv_private.h1288 struct list_head pool_link; member
/third_party/mesa3d/src/amd/vulkan/
Dradv_cmd_buffer.c419 list_del(&cmd_buffer->pool_link); in radv_destroy_cmd_buffer()
466 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in radv_create_cmd_buffer()
4299 list_first_entry(&pool->free_cmd_buffers, struct radv_cmd_buffer, pool_link); in radv_AllocateCommandBuffers()
4301 list_del(&cmd_buffer->pool_link); in radv_AllocateCommandBuffers()
4302 list_addtail(&cmd_buffer->pool_link, &pool->cmd_buffers); in radv_AllocateCommandBuffers()
4347 list_del(&cmd_buffer->pool_link); in radv_FreeCommandBuffers()
4348 list_addtail(&cmd_buffer->pool_link, &cmd_buffer->pool->free_cmd_buffers); in radv_FreeCommandBuffers()
5681 list_for_each_entry_safe(struct radv_cmd_buffer, cmd_buffer, &pool->cmd_buffers, pool_link) in radv_DestroyCommandPool()
5686 list_for_each_entry_safe(struct radv_cmd_buffer, cmd_buffer, &pool->free_cmd_buffers, pool_link) in radv_DestroyCommandPool()
5701 list_for_each_entry(struct radv_cmd_buffer, cmd_buffer, &pool->cmd_buffers, pool_link) in radv_ResetCommandPool()
[all …]
Dradv_private.h1467 struct list_head pool_link; member